What is the main advantage of an electromagnet?

The main advantage of an electromagnet over a permanent magnet is

that the magnetic field can be quickly changed by controlling the amount of electric current in the winding

. However, unlike a permanent magnet that needs no power, an electromagnet requires a continuous supply of current to maintain the magnetic field.

What is an electromagnet state its advantages class 10?

Advantages of electromagnets

An

electromagnet can produce a strong magnetic field and its strength can be controlled by changing the strength of the current or the number of turns in the coil

. The polarity of an electromagnet can be changed by reversing the direction of the current that flows in the solenoid.

Are electromagnets permanent or temporary?

An electromagnet is

a temporary magnet

. It is made by winding a coil of insulated wire round a soft iron core. When a current is passed through the coil, the magnetic field produced by the current magnetises the soft iron core. The soft iron core loses all the magnetism when the current is switched off.

What can make an electromagnet stronger?

  • wrapping the coil around a piece of iron (such as an iron nail)
  • adding more turns to the coil.
  • increasing the current flowing through the coil.

What is electromagnet short answer?

An electromagnet is

a magnet that runs on electricity

. Unlike a permanent magnet, the strength of an electromagnet can easily be changed by changing the amount of electric current that flows through it. The poles of an electromagnet can even be reversed by reversing the flow of electricity.
